  • Abstract
    A novel Ka-band Rx/Tx channel duplexer design with tuning capability is established for the 26GHz band. Thus, only a single hardware is necessary to serve all duplex channel combinations of the overall radio frequency band - a prerequisite for large scale low cost unit production. The applied filters consider optimal tailored transfer functions with transmission zeros, realized with compact planar overmoded TE103 cavity structures to accommodate the extreme rejection demands while maintaining low insertion loss. A further design aspect has been easy integration and interfacing into the waveguide subsystem of the radio equipment. The complete duplexer structure has been designed using a mode matching based CAD. To satisfy the stability of the responses for the given outdoor environmental conditions it has been realized from silverplated INVAR sheets - a technique supporting the low cost issue. Good agreement of computed and measured results and the successful testing of the tuning capability verifies the design.
